NASHVILLE, Tenn. -- Pittsburgh coach Mike Tomlin isn't sure who's going to play quarterback next for his Steelers. The way his defense is playing, it might not matter.
Antonio Brown scored on an 89-yard kickoff return to open the game, and the Pittsburgh Steelers forced seven turnovers in defeating the Tennessee Titans 19-11 Sunday.Don't See That Everday
The Steelers' 19-11 win over the Titans was just the third game in NFL history to end by that score.
| Date | Score |
|---|---|
| Sept. 19, 2010 | Steelers 19 Titans 11* |
| Nov. 12, 2000 | Browns 19 Patriots 11 |
| Sept. 30, 1961 | Chargers 19 Bills 11* |
| *Won by visiting team -- Source: ESPN Stats and Information |

Game notes
Pittsburgh now is 14-3 in September against the Titans since 1970. ... It was Polamalu's 22nd interception of his career. He also had one last week. ... The Steelers hadn't won in Nashville since Nov. 25, 2001. ... The Steelers came into this game with an NFL-least 825 points allowed since the start of the 2007 season. ... Johnson has yet to reach 100 yards rushing in three games against Pittsburgh. Johnson had averaged 145.6 yards in his previous seven home games.
